Deezer’s New Tool Exposes AI Tracks on Spotify, Apple Music
Deezer is has just launched a free online AI tool, giving music streaming users across 20 of the most common platforms the opportunity to check if their playlists include AI-generated tracks.
Available in 27 languages, the new “AI Music Detector” does not limit its functionality to Deezer subscribers. Instead, it lets users from over 20 rival streaming platforms, including Spotify and Apple Music, to connect their accounts and scan their personal playlists for synthetic tracks.
The launch follows alarming data released by Deezer regarding the sheer volume of artificial audio entering the streaming ecosystem. According to internal metrics, nearly 75,000 fully AI-generated tracks are uploaded to streaming services every single day. This massive influx accounts for roughly 44 per cent of all new music deliveries globally.
While these robotic songs make up only a tiny sliver of actual consumer listenership, estimated at 1-3% of total streams, their presence remains highly controversial. Deezer executives revealed that up to 85% of the plays generated by these AI tracks are entirely fraudulent.
To combat this, Deezer developed an in-house system to spot and flag music built by generative platforms like Suno and Udio. The platform automatically strips detected AI music from its editorial playlists and algorithmic recommendations. Now, the company is handing that exact technology over to the public to let consumers audit their own listening habits.
“By detecting and tagging AI generated music over the past year and a half, Deezer has been at the forefront of transparency in music streaming,” said Alexis Lanternier, CEO of Deezer. “No other company has followed our lead yet, so we decided to make it possible for everyone to check if their playlists include synthetic music, no matter which streaming platform they use.”
Listeners who want to audit their libraries can visit the official web tool, select their current music provider, and grant the secure scanner permission to review their saved songs.
